Sharing experiences of cultural pressure during festivals and family gatherings — how do we handle it?

🌱 Belong Community Resource
As we approach festival season, many of us might feel that familiar mix of excitement and anxiety. Family gatherings can be a beautiful time to celebrate our rich Agarwal traditions, but they can also bring a lot of pressure. From expectations around how we dress to what we achieve, it can sometimes feel overwhelming to balance our own identities with what our families envision for us. One thing that’s helped me is setting boundaries before the festivities begin. For instance, if you know a relative will ask about your career or relationship status, it might be helpful to prepare a light-hearted response in advance. This way, you’re ready to steer the conversation in a direction that feels more comfortable for you. Many of us find that humor can be a great way to deflect pressure without causing tension. Another approach is to find moments during gatherings where we can connect with family members who share similar feelings. I’ve found that chatting with cousins or siblings who understand the cultural pressure can be a relief. We’ve started a little tradition of taking breaks together, stepping outside for fresh air or grabbing a quiet moment away from the crowd. It’s a small act, but it really helps to feel that solidarity during those times when the pressure feels the heaviest. Also, don’t underestimate the power of storytelling. Sharing our experiences about navigating cultural expectations can create a sense of community, even within our own families. When I opened up about feeling torn between tradition and my own aspirations, I found that others felt the same way. It’s comforting to realize that we’re not alone in this.
